About the position:

This is a critical position in our company.  As the face and champion of our brand, you will manage the talent acquisition process to meet our huge hiring needs this year and beyond.  Your success will be measured by your ability to identify and hire A players to join our dream team,

Snapshot of key accountabilities:

  • Attract, source, screen and coordinate interviews for sales, marketing, operations, customer service, project managers, developers and programmers and interns and other non- executive level positions
  • Foster and manage relationships with our established network of universities and colleges to nurture and grow our robust internship program; manage campus recruitment programs and job fairs
  • Effectively utilize a variety of sourcing methods including LinkedIn and other social media, networking, and other creative methods
  • Coordinate with hiring managers to identify staffing needs and collaborate with management to be sure we have solid job descriptions and hiring criteria for each position
  • Constantly build and maintain an exceptional pipeline of candidates
  • Provide candidates with an engaging candidate experience

Skills/Experience/Knowledge required:

  • 3 -5 years of recruitment experience in a corporate or agency setting
  • In-depth understanding of sourcing tools including social media recruiting
  • Strong experience building a pipeline of great talent
  • Thrive in a fast paced environment that demands results
  • Natural ability to connect with others quickly and nurture strong relationships with our university network, candidates, and our team
  • Knowledge of applicable Federal and State regulations (AA, EEO, ADA, etc)
  • Technologically savvy
  • Strong proficiency with MS Office (Word, Excel, Outlook, PowerPoint)
  • Bachelors Degree highly preferred (AA Degree at a minimum)
